Abstract
Even if we use conventional aerial firefighting methods, it is not easy to extinguish huge-forest fires. In this paper, we have proposed a new extinguishing method using gel balls containing high-viscosity fluid, which acts as an extinguishing agent, and attempted to fabricate physically cross-linked gel particles of sodium alginate in which xanthan gum aqueous solution is retained. Then, in order to examine the basic properties of the gel particles in high-temperature atmosphere, we observed the temporal changes in shape and mass of the gel particles on a high-temperature wall. As a result, it was confirmed that the gel particles contained more than 96% water and can supply water vapor over a long period of time.
